Hulu with Live Reaches 4.1 Million Subscribers, Holding Its Title as Top Live TV Streaming Service
In Disney’s Q4 2020 financial report today, the company announced that Hulu with Live has reached 4.1 million subscribers, an increase of 41% year over year. Disney+ Reaches 73 Million Subscribers on Its One Year Anniversary
In today’s Q4 2020 earnings report, Disney announced that Disney+ has reached 73 million subscribers, up from the 60.5 million reported at the end of the previous quarter. Today marks the one year anniversary of the streaming service’s launch. Hulu Breaks Records with Election Night 2020
Election Night, November 3, broke records on Hulu as it became the most watched event ever on the streaming service, with over 65% of Hulu with Live subscribers tuning in to watch coverage.
